Kenzie was a beloved daughter, granddaughter, sister, aunt, dog mom, and friend. Mackenzie Gail McAvoy left this world unexpectedly, at 19 on May 6, 2022. Born in Dunedin, Florida on August 28, 2002, to David and Mary Beth (Nolf) McAvoy, Kenzie grew up in Weeki Wachee, where she attended Weeki Wachee High School, graduate class of 2020 and was currently working on her Associated Degree at Pasco Hernando State College.
Those who knew Kenzie, even just a little, lost a shining light in their lives. Although only 19 at the time of her death, Kenzie affected many people in her lifetime. She was deeply committed to being a handler, loving and caring unconditionally for any and every dog near and far. She was fiercely loyal to her family, friends, and dog children. We will always remember her infectious smile, hardworking, and caring personality.
We know Kenzie is now with her Grandpa Proctor, Grandma Gail, Uncle Doug, Uncle Skippy, and nephew Brayden and is loved here on earth as well as heaven. She leaves behind her parents, David and Mary Beth; sisters, Cortney (Wyatt) and Nicole; niece, Kinsley; nephew, Jackson; grandparents, Jim and Pat; dog children, Zander and Aspen; and many aunts, uncles, cousins, as well as dog family and friends.
A service will take place Saturday, May 14 at 2:30 p.m. at Hodges Family Funeral Home in Dade City, Fl. A visitation will take place prior from 1:30 p.m. to 2:30 p.m.. Interment will follow service at Trilby Cemetery in Dade City.
